CSC Danhai LRT EPC Project

Connecting New Taipei City's Diverse Communities with Modern LRT Technology

Taiwan's Northern Coast attracts countless visitors to its pristine shoreline and rich historical sites, and is home to many vibrant communities. Danhai New Town, which hugs the northern edge of New Taipei City, is one of those communities. With its growing population, Danhai requires high-quality public transportation to meet its citizens' needs. That's why, in 2013, government authorities approved an extensive Light Rail Transit (LRT) system for the region.

PECL played an important role in turning the Blue and Green lines of the Danhai LRT into reality. Our physical footprint on this project includes over 14 kilometers of track (both at-grade and on viaducts), 14 stations, and a 4.95 hectare depot complex. China Steel Corporation (CSC) – the EPC contractor on the project selected PECL to provide the detailed design for its work. We performed full discipline design for sub-grade, at grade and superstructure facilities along the entire alignment, including working with the Ministry of Transportation for the proper consideration of the roads and highways impacted within our design. This role included creating digital models of viaduct landscaping, stations, and depots. These models gave CSC a 360˚ view of the project and its challenges long before any track was built. In addition, we designed the system's overhead catenary system – the overhead wires that keep the trains running. For its design and modeling efforts, PECL was awarded the Digital Innovation Award and Engineering Environment and Landscaping Super-Excellent Award by the Chinese Institute of Civil and Hydraulic Engineering. But the greatest reward of all came in December 2018 and November 2020, when Green Line and Phase I of the Blue Line respectively opened to the public.

Green & Blue Lines: At-a-Glance

  • Track: 14.1 km total, 5.66 km of viaducts, 8.44 km at-grade
  • Stations: CSA & MEPF engineering for 14 stations, 7 elevated and 7 at-grade
  • Depot: 4.95 ha total, including main workshop, stabling yard, administration building
  • Level Crossing: EPC scope for 18 level crossings
  • Core System: Overhead Catenary System; Power Supply System; At-grade SIG System

BIM Implementation

The Danhai LRT enjoys another honor: it is recognized as one of the first transportation projects in Taiwan to incorporate BIM into station design, civil engineering, and railway planning throughout the design and construction stages -- including conceptual/detail design, fabrication, and construction. The use of BIM enabled crystal clear visualization, and ensured smooth communication with the owner and customer. For customers and contractors alike, the biggest headaches come from small errors in the design and construction stage, which require costly rework. PECL utilized BIM to facilitate clash management and space optimization, allowing the project team to spot and correct errors long before they turned into liabilities. Through the integration of BIM with GIS (Geographic Information Systems), PECL was able to generate maps, models, and 3D visualizations that could more accurately depict the impact of our designs on the local environment and finalizes the railway alignment. These capabilities allowed us to fine tune our designs to minimize any potential harm to the environment, enhancing the sustainability of the project.
